Nedir Bey, who allegedly once tortured a man and then scored a $1.1 million loan from the City of Oakland that he never repaid, lost a $750,000 BART station lighting contract last night when he failed to turn in the proper paperwork by the deadline, the Trib and the SF Weekly report. In addition, Bey's failure to follow the contract's requirements means that BART may lose the state funding for the lighting project at the North Berkeley BART station.
The state had given BART a deadline of October 31 to use the funding for the contract. In other words, it looks like BART will have to forfeit much-needed state funds because the agency's board decided to award a contract to an ex-felon and deadbeat who then couldn't fulfill the requirements of the deal.
